The common warthog is a short, relatively small and stocky animal. It is grey colored with a bristly mane running down its back and its head is flat and shovel-like. Males are larger than females, and have warty protrusions on their face. Both genders have sharp, curved tusks that are substantially larger on the males.

The common warthog (Phacochoerus africanus) is a wild member of the pig family found in grassland, savanna, and woodland in sub-Saharan Africa. [1] [2] In the past, it was commonly treated as a subspecies of P. aethiopicus, but today that scientific name is restricted to the desert warthog of northern Kenya, Somalia, and eastern Ethiopia. warthog, (Phacochoerus aethiopicus), member of the pig family, Suidae (order Artiodactyla), found in open and lightly forested areas of Africa. The warthog is a sparsely haired, large-headed, blackish or brown animal standing about 76 centimetres (30 inches) at the shoulder.

Warthogs live in Africa's grassy savanna. At first glance, the warthog resembles the wild boar, but with a comparatively flat and slightly over-sized head, further pronounced by their large tusks. Long bristles form a mane on the warthog's back and neck. Its tail ends in a tuft of bristles.

Home, sweet aardvark hole: Warthogs live in Africa's southern Sudan and southwestern Ethiopia, in savanna woodland and grasslands—and they are not picky about their homes. Instead of digging their own burrows, they find abandoned aardvark holes or natural burrows for homes. This is where they raise their young, sleep, and hide from predators.

The common warthog (Phacochoerus africanus) is a wild member of the pig family, Suidae, found in grassland, savanna, and woodland in sub-Saharan Africa. There are four subspecies — Nolan warthog, Eritrean warthog, Central African warthog and Southern warthog.
